William Dexter Coakley (born October 20, 1972) is an American former professional football player who was a linebacker for ten seasons in the National Football League (NFL). He played college football in Division I-AA for the Appalachian State Mountaineers, and was selected in the third round of the 1997 NFL draft by the Dallas Cowboys. Coakley was elected to the College Football Hall of Fame in 2011, making him Appalachian State's first inductee.
